My tripod (an update)


In my last post I wrote about trying a tripod tutorial to overcome my lack of motivation... And I did! In the video  "How to Make a Textured Tripod Pot With Soft Slabs" at Ceramic Arts Daily, Sandi Pierantozzi made it look easy... And it was! I used gutter guard for texture as suggested and I REALLY like it. I forgot about all of the everyday things that can be used.

Tripod Tutorial

This week I've been feeling really blah and unmotivated. I haven't exercised. I haven't made anything. The most creative thing I've done is choose some new favorites on Etsy! Ugh.

It's time to get myself out of this rut... So I looked up some tutorials and found one that I really want to try:


In the video  "How to Make a Textured Tripod Pot With Soft Slabs" at Ceramic Arts Daily, Sandi Pierantozzi explains how to texture the slab (she used gutter guard), create an even tripod, bulge the sides out, and then add some finishing touches. It is inspiring and simple! Well, she makes it look easy. I'm going to spend some clay time in the studio on Sunday and will give you an update on how it actually goes! Find the video HERE.
